Wednesday, April 29, 2009
This is it....

Again, I have been too busy to update this blog. (So what else is new?) What have I been up to lately? Well, I'am currently doing my OJTs, and yes OJT"s" I spelled that right, TV, Print and Radio.

Just finished my training with RMN Networks, its a national Radio station. Got to Interview some pretty interesting people and I had the chance to join the KBP Sportsfest, which was a blast by the way. Now, I am with Brigada News Philippines, its a local daily here in Gensan and it has sisters in CDO and DVO. So far I've had the chance to interview Vice Governor Steve Solon of Saranggani, Mayor Enrique Yap of Glan, Chief Senior Inspector Roy Romualdo of Glan, SFC. Larry Aarron of the Joint Special Operations Task Force-Philippines and Angela Ripdos the Municipal Planning and Development Coordinator and etc. I've also had the chance to attend the US Army Medical Mission in Pangyan, The International Training Course on the Investigation and Prosecution of Extrajudicial Killings, Enforced Disapperances and Torture for Public Prosecutors, Human Rights Workers and other Legal Professionals organized by the American Bar Association and the Center for International Law and I attended a small rally organized by a local transport group.

Tomorrow I'll be covering the General Santos City Police Office Basketball Tournament and I'll be Interviewing the ATO Security Manager for Gen. Santos International Airport and I'll will also be doing an interview with the Gensan top cop PSSI.Robert Po.

-Loving my course! hehehe...
